Answer:

The graph in the attached figure

Explanation:

we have


5x + 2y = 2 ------> equation A


3x-3y=18 ------> equation B

Using a graphing tool

we know that

The solution of the system of equations is the intersection point both graphs

The intersection point is
(2,-4)

see the attached figure

Therefore

The solution of the system of equations is


x=2,y=-4
